Y

Yechiel Bromberg

9 months ago

I had a wonderful experience working with this com...

I had a wonderful experience working with this company. The work environment is fantastic, and the opportunities for growth are endless. The management is supportive and encourages innovation. I highly recommend this company.

Comments:

No comments